HOLLAND (WHTC-AM/FM) — Coldwell Banker Woodland Schmidt has organized a panel of experts discussion on the effects of water erosion along the Lakeshore.
It’s set for 6:30 to 8:30 p.m., Thursday, Feb. 27, 2020, at the Holland Civic Center Place, 150 E. Eighth St. (at Pine Avenue).
The panel includes:
District 90 State Rep. Bradley Slagh; GVSU professor and ecological researcher Kevin Strychar; Attorney Scott Kraemer; Greg Weykamp of Edgewater Resources; property appraiser John Meyer; emergency managers: Ottawa County’s Nick Bonstell, and Allegan County’s Scott Corbin, who is also a Holland City councilman; Jerrod Sanders of the Michigan Department of Environment, Great Lakes, and Energyand professional engineer John Allis of the US Army Corps of Engineers.
The evening is free and open to the public.
